A duifficult one on the carbon issue. Grid electricity generates around 500g of CO2 for each kWh of energy delivered. So an EV getting 250Wh/mile is producing about 125g of CO2 per mile or 78g/km which is better than a Prius. Also wheras our Berlingo gets about 300-350Wh/mile (110g CO2/km at worst)....
